Windows窗体中的应用程序启动标志?

时间:2009-07-01 18:33:25

标签: .net winforms

Windows窗体应用程序是否有办法检测是否已将任何标志添加到用于启动它的命令/快捷方式中?就像我想去“app.exe / flag”一样,我可以以编程方式在某处获得“/ flag”吗?

2 个答案:

答案 0 :(得分:3)

您可以使用Environment.GetCommandLineArgs()获取传递给程序的参数数组。

答案 1 :(得分:0)

另一种方法是处理Application Startup事件,您可以访问StartupEventArgs,该CommandLine具有名为{{1}}的属性,该属性是命令行的只读集合参数。